Academic Portal

Project

An Intranet portal designed to provide easy access to all research and academic needs of faculty and students.

Context

When the school's Internet website was outsourced to a professional design group, a need arose for an easier interface for academic users and designers.

Conditions 

  • A collaborative effort between technology, English and library staffs.
  • FrontPage was required software.
  • Designed and maintained by one individual.

Scope 

  • Project was successfully implemented over three years ago and has undergone dynamic modifications since then.
  • Library staff gradually learned to maintain and modify their content.
  • Student and faculty web pages are easily accessed thereby eliminating the need to remember cumbersome addresses.
  • Technical training materials have been centralized.

Role

  • Provides a base for developing exemplary learning objects, with much training provided as both print and video.
  • Enhanced student access to Writing Workshop.
